New naval incident in the South China Sea: Beijing accuses the US of “gravely violating China’s sovereignty and security”

The Chinese military closely monitored and “repelled” the USS Halsey that entered the territorial waters of the Paracel Islands in the South China Sea on May 10, the People’s Liberation Army’s Southern Theater Command said in a statement on Friday. Reuters and AFP, taken over by news.ro.

The American maneuver “seriously violated China’s sovereignty and security”, says the Beijing army.

“It is yet another undeniable proof of its maritime hegemony and militarization of the South China Sea,” she said, adding that her troops would remain on high alert and protect national security.

Beijing “ordered the naval and air forces to track and monitor the ship in accordance with laws and regulations and issued a warning to make it leave,” Chinese military spokesman Tian Junli said, quoted by AFP.

For its part, the US Navy stated in a statement that the destroyer asserted its rights and freedoms of navigation in the South China Sea, near the Paracel Islands, “in accordance with international law.”

The USS Halsey left the area after this operation and continued its course through the South China Sea, the statement said.

The U.S. Navy’s 7th Fleet had previously announced that the Arleigh Burke-class guided-missile destroyer USS Halsey conducted a “routine transit” of the Taiwan Strait on Wednesday, “through waters where freedoms of navigation and overflight apply, in compliance with international law”. This move had also been denounced by the Chinese military, which said it was a “public unrest”, stating that it had sent naval and air forces to monitor and warn the US ship throughout its passage, “in accordance with the law and regulations “.

“Troops in the theater of operations are always on alert and will resolutely defend national sovereignty and security, as well as regional peace and stability,” the Eastern Theater Command of the People’s Liberation Army said in a statement.

The latest dispute between China and the US comes amid heightened tensions in the strategic South China Sea, with US ally the Philippines embroiled in a bitter diplomatic row with Beijing over disputed waters in the region. China claims large portions of the South China Sea, including parts also claimed by the Philippines, Vietnam, Indonesia, Malaysia and Brunei. In 2016, the Permanent Court of Arbitration ruled that Beijing’s claims had no basis in international law.
